subject: Why Choose Self Catering Cottages? [print this page] One of the biggest expenses with taking a holiday is the cost of accommodation. A lot of people these days are choosing to book into self catering cottages or apartments at their chosen holiday destination. Staying in self catering accommodation can be cheaper for families staying for longer periods, and you have the freedom of more privacy than in a hotel or B and B. The cottages include all the necessary items to make your stay comfortable. Linens and towels, crockery and cutlery, pillows and duvets, cooker, microwave, refrigerator, washer, TV, DVD player etc. are provided. All the comforts of your own home!

Self catering cottages range from farm houses, town or country houses, apartments, converted barns and quaint fisherman's cottages. The cottages are privately owned, and the owners choose to advertise on the internet to appeal to a wider range of prospective clients. Some sites manage the properties for the owners for a fee. You book directly online and pay the letting agent the same way. At the end of your stay you are asked to fill in a questionnaire about the property. This way they can ensure that the properties are of a high standard at all times. Some sites only advertise the cottage and you contact the owners directly to book and pay.
